Board rejects pause to reconsider South parish high‑school site; motion to pause fails

A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

A proposal to pause the southern high‑school project and consult realtors on alternative sites failed after debate about traffic, prior land purchase and tax‑plan timing; the board voted to continue with existing schedule.

Board member Powell Lewis moved — and Board member Powell Lewis seconded — a motion to pause the southern high‑school project in the tax plan and send the proposal to the oversight committee while staff reviewed alternative sites.
